What Are Backlogs in Study Abroad Applications?

A backlog means a subject you have not cleared in your previous semester exams and had to reattempt later.

Universities usually look at:

  • Number of backlogs (cleared + pending)

  • Whether all backlogs are cleared before application

  • Academic trend (improving or declining performance)

  • Overall GPA / percentage

πŸ‘‰ Important: Most universities care more about final cleared backlogs than temporary failures.

Can You Study Abroad with Backlogs?

Yes, but conditions apply:

βœ”οΈ You CAN apply if:

  • All backlogs are cleared before admission

  • You have a strong overall GPA (usually 55%–70%+ depending on country)

  • You meet English requirements (IELTS/TOEFL/Duolingo)

  • You have strong SOP and supporting documents

❌ You may face rejection if:

  • You have active (uncleared) backlogs

  • You have too many repeated failures in core subjects

  • Low academic performance + weak profile

Country-Wise Acceptance of Backlogs

Different countries have different flexibility levels:

πŸ‡©πŸ‡ͺ Germany

  • Usually allows 0–5 cleared backlogs

  • Strong focus on academics and GPA

  • Technical courses (Engineering, CS) are competitive

πŸ‘‰ Best for students with strong academics but few backlogs

πŸ‡¨πŸ‡¦ Canada

  • Moderate flexibility

  • Most colleges accept few cleared backlogs

  • Universities are stricter than colleges

πŸ‘‰ Good option if profile is overall strong

πŸ‡¬πŸ‡§ United Kingdom

  • Accepts students with limited backlogs (cleared)

  • Strong SOP can help compensate

πŸ‘‰ Faster admission process compared to others

πŸ‡¦πŸ‡Ί Australia

  • Generally flexible

  • Focus on overall percentage and English score

πŸ‘‰ Good for students with average academic profiles

πŸ‡ΊπŸ‡Έ United States

  • Most flexible country

  • Backlogs are acceptable if cleared

  • Holistic admission process (SOP, projects, GRE/IELTS optional for some)

πŸ‘‰ Best option for students with mixed academic history

How Many Backlogs Are Acceptable?

There is no universal rule, but general expectations:

  • 0–5 backlogs → Safe for most countries

  • 5–10 backlogs → Limited options (colleges, conditional admits)

  • 10+ backlogs → Difficult but still possible with pathway programs

πŸ‘‰ The key factor is whether you have cleared them before application.

How to Improve Your Chances If You Have Backlogs

Even if you have backlogs, you can still build a strong profile:

1. Improve Your GPA

A higher overall percentage can balance your profile.

2. Write a Strong SOP (Statement of Purpose)

Explain:

  • Why backlogs happened (be honest but not defensive)

  • What you learned from them

  • Why you are now academically prepared

3. Add Certifications

Boost your profile with:

  • Coursera / Udemy courses

  • Technical certifications (AWS, Python, Data Science, etc.)

4. Choose the Right Country & University

Not all universities have the same strictness.

5. Apply Early

Early applicants often get better chances for conditional offers.

Common Myths About Backlogs

❌ Myth 1: You cannot study abroad with any backlog
βœ”οΈ Reality: Cleared backlogs are accepted in many countries

❌ Myth 2: Backlogs ruin your entire profile
βœ”οΈ Reality: SOP, skills, and GPA matter equally

❌ Myth 3: Only top students go abroad
βœ”οΈ Reality: Many average students successfully study abroad every year
